Coxsackie
Coxsackie is a village in Greene County, New York, United States. The population was 2,746 at the 2020 census. The village name comes from the native word mak-kachs-hack-ing.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lampman Hill
Peak
Lampman Hill is a mountain in Greene County, New York. It is located in the Catskill Mountains southeast of Coxsackie. High Rocks is located north-northwest, and Flint Mine Hill is located west-southwest of Lampman Hill.
Coxsackie Correctional Facility
Prison
Coxsackie Correctional Facility is a maximum security state prison in Coxsackie, Greene County, New York. It currently houses approximately 900 inmates. It is classified as a maximum security general confinement facility and detention center for men.
Greene Correctional Facility
Prison
The Greene Correctional Facility is a state prison for men located in Coxsackie, Greene County, New York, owned and operated by the New York State Department of Corrections and Community Supervision.

Stuyvesant
Village

Stuyvesant is a town in Columbia County, New York, United States. The population was 1,931 at the 2020 census, down from 2,027 at the 2010 census. The town is in the northwest corner of Columbia County. U.S. Route 9 crosses the southeastern corner of the town. Stuyvesant is situated 2½ miles northeast of Coxsackie.
Climax
Hamlet
Climax is a hamlet in the town of Coxsackie, Greene County, New York, United States. The zipcode is 12042. Climax is situated 2½ miles west of Coxsackie.
Sleepy Hollow Lake
Village

Sleepy Hollow Lake is a recreational lake and residential community in Greene County, New York, United States, located 120 miles north of New York City and 28 miles south of Albany in the Hudson River Valley. Sleepy Hollow Lake is situated 3½ miles south of Coxsackie.
